You’re Not “Bad at Writing," You’re Busy Running a Business

Let’s start here, because this is the root of the hesitation.


Most business owners don’t lack skill, they lack time.


Content takes mental bandwidth, creative energy, focus, strategy, and consistency. And you? You’re juggling clients, chasing invoices, putting out fires, launching offers, planning events, answering emails, networking, selling and the list goes on. That’s why hiring a professional writer isn’t indulgent. It’s smart business.


It’s the same as hiring an accountant, a bookkeeper, a designer, or a social-media manager because you bring in experts so you can stay in your zone of genius.
